Whether in class, in groups, or at schools, invite your students to reflect on the world of tomorrow through the competition theme “Interconnected: human – digital – sustainable” and to create an artwork, media, or concrete action project on this subject. From primary school to secondary II, regardless of subject area, everyone can participate in this unique educational competition in Switzerland, which aims to raise awareness of the impact of new technologies on people and sustainability.  

Projects can be submitted until the end of February 2026, and all participants will be invited to the ceremony at the UN in Geneva (subject to room capacity). What's more, your works may also be exhibited there !

The Françoise Demole Award: a springboard for your concrete projects! 

Aimed at secondary II classes, the Françoise Demole Award brings the most inspiring ideas to life within the framework of the Eduki Competition. Whether it’s a local initiative, an awareness campaign, or a sustainable action, it encourages students to design, budget, and implement a project with meaning and impact. 

🎥 Discover how the 2023/2024 winners took on the challenge! 

Composting, anti-waste, reforestation… these students have proven that acting for a sustainable future is possible! 

CFPP Genève – “Allez les vers (le retour)” : creation of a composting system for the cafeteria's food waste, allowing the cultivation of herbs and vegetables used by the chefs — a great circular economy initiative at the school. 

Lycée Blaise-Cendrars (NE) – “Xirup l'élixir de fruit” : a mini-enterprise founded by five students to produce syrups made from unsold fruit, a sustainable and healthy alternative to industrial beverages. 

Lycée Blaise-Cendrars, La Chaux-de-Fonds (NE) – Hive’Five : Handmade production of local honey candies, with a portion of the profits donated to an association that replants trees after the 2023 storm — a project that is both sweet and supportive.
